e2107 Posté(e) le 17 janvier 2022 Signaler Share Posté(e) le 17 janvier 2022 Bonjour, j’aurais besoin d’un éclaircissement pour ce sujet qui m’est inconnu. Merci beaucoup.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
E-Bahut julesx Posté(e) le 17 janvier 2022 E-Bahut Signaler Share Posté(e) le 17 janvier 2022 Bonsoir, Je ne peux pas t'aider en détail car, de toute façon, je ne sais pas coder en C. Cela dit, en ce qui concerne les différents algorithmes de tri, tu trouveras tout ce qu'il faut sur la toile, y compris des portions de code. J'ai été voir, j'ai pu sans problème concevoir un script complet en Python, langage que je maitrise un tout petit peu. A mon avis, la seule chose qui va être vraiment de ton cru est la façon dont tu conçois l'élaboration de la liste des 50 valeurs de départ et la façon de prélever les 10 ou 15 valeurs à trier. Personnellement, j'ai élaboré une liste de 50 valeurs aléatoires différentes à prendre sur un intervalle d'entiers de 1 à 1000 et j'ai pris les 10 ou 15 premières pour les trier. Mais on peut affiner ce choix en prenant en plus les valeurs de façon aléatoire par les 50, bien que je n'en voie pas vraiment l'intérêt. Voilà, mais peut-être que tu auras plus de précisions avec un autre intervenant.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
e2107 Posté(e) le 18 janvier 2022 Auteur Signaler Share Posté(e) le 18 janvier 2022 Bonjour ! Merci pour ta réponse complète ! Si tu pouvais me donner les démarches qui t’ont permis d’élaborer cet algorithme dont tu parles dans ton message alors ça m’aiderais vraiment beaucoup.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
E-Bahut julesx Posté(e) le 18 janvier 2022 E-Bahut Signaler Share Posté(e) le 18 janvier 2022 Bonjour, Pour les démarches concernant les différentes méthodes de tri, je me suis contenté de regarder ce qui se disait sur la toile et de reprendre les portions de code qui s'y trouvaient. Je pense qu'il vaut mieux que tu fasses pareil, d'autant plus qu'à certains endroits, il y a des animations pour montrer comment ça fonctionne. Pour l'élaboration de la liste, j'ai procédé ainsi : Initialisation d'une liste vide notée L0 c'est le tableau dans lequel on choisira les 10 ou 15 valeurs Pour i variant de 1 à 50 n prend une valeur aléatoire entre 1 et 1000 Tant que n est déjà dans la liste n prend une valeur aléatoire entre 1 et 1000 Ceci permet de ne pas avoir deux valeurs identiques dans la liste Fin Tant que n est ajoutée à L L prend les 10 ou 15 premières valeurs de L0. Cela dit, est-ce ça que tu voulais ? si oui, il faut remplacer la notion de liste par la notion de tableau car, d'après ce que j'ai vu, C ne connait pas les listes. Citer Lien vers le commentaire Partager sur d’autres sites More sharing options...
Messages recommandés
Rejoindre la conversation
Vous pouvez publier maintenant et vous inscrire plus tard. Si vous avez un compte, connectez-vous maintenant pour publier avec votre compte.